Faq about top rated cross country mountain bikes:
1:What are the best cross country mountain bikes?
The best cross country mountain bikes include brands like Specialized, Trek, and Cannondale, known for their lightweight frames and efficient suspension systems.
2:What features should I look for in a cross country mountain bike?
Look for a lightweight frame, good suspension, quality components, and geometry designed for speed and efficiency on varied terrain.
3:Are full suspension bikes better for cross country riding?
Full suspension bikes provide better comfort and control on rough trails, making them popular among cross country riders, but hardtails are lighter and more efficient on smoother paths.
4:What is the average price of a top rated cross country mountain bike?
Top rated cross country mountain bikes typically range from $2,000 to $10,000, depending on the brand, materials, and technology.
5:How do I choose the right size for a cross country mountain bike?
To choose the right size, measure your height and inseam, then consult the manufacturer’s sizing chart to find the best fit for your body type.
6:Can I use a cross country mountain bike for trails and downhill riding?
While cross country bikes excel on smooth trails, they are not ideal for downhill riding. For that, consider a bike designed specifically for downhill or all-mountain riding.
